从零学编程语言要求是什么
-
从零学习编程语言需要具备以下要求:
-
基础的计算机知识:学习编程语言之前,需要了解计算机的基本原理,包括计算机的组成、操作系统的功能和运行原理等。这将帮助你理解编程语言的运行环境和基本概念。
-
数学基础:编程语言通常涉及到数学运算和逻辑判断,因此具备一定的数学基础是必要的。特别是在学习一些高级编程语言时,对于数学概念的理解将帮助你更好地理解和应用编程语言。
-
学习能力和耐心:学习编程语言需要一定的耐心和毅力。编程语言的学习过程中可能会遇到各种难题和困难,需要持续的学习和实践来提高自己的编程能力。
-
掌握基本的编程概念和语法:编程语言有各种不同的语法和规则,学习编程语言需要掌握基本的编程概念,如变量、数据类型、运算符、控制流程等。通过学习和实践,逐步掌握编程语言的基本语法和常用功能。
-
实践和项目经验:学习编程语言最好的方式是通过实践和项目经验。通过编写小程序、解决实际问题或参与开源项目等方式,可以更好地理解和应用编程语言,同时提高自己的编程能力。
总之,学习编程语言需要具备计算机基础知识、数学基础、学习能力和耐心,掌握基本的编程概念和语法,并通过实践和项目经验来提高自己的编程能力。
1年前 -
-
从零学习编程语言需要具备以下要求:
-
基本的数学和逻辑思维能力:编程语言是一种用于解决问题和实现算法的工具,因此需要具备基本的数学和逻辑思维能力。理解数学概念,如变量、函数、算术运算符和逻辑运算符,能够进行简单的数学计算和逻辑推理是学习编程语言的基础。
-
学习意愿和耐心:学习编程语言需要耐心和毅力,因为编程语言的学习过程可能会遇到困难和挑战。需要有持续的学习意愿和坚持不懈的态度,解决问题的决心和毅力是成功学习编程语言的关键。
-
编程思维:编程语言是一种表达思想和解决问题的工具,因此需要具备良好的编程思维。编程思维包括分析问题、抽象问题、设计算法、编写代码和调试代码等能力。需要学会将问题分解为小的模块,使用适当的数据结构和算法来解决问题。
-
学习资源和工具:学习编程语言需要合适的学习资源和工具。可以通过在线教程、视频课程、编程书籍和编程论坛等途径获取学习资源。同时,需要选择合适的集成开发环境(IDE)或文本编辑器来编写和运行代码。
-
实践和项目经验:学习编程语言最好的方式是通过实践和项目经验来巩固所学知识。可以通过编写小型程序、解决编程问题和参与开源项目等方式来提高编程技能。实践中会遇到各种问题和挑战,通过解决这些问题可以加深对编程语言的理解和掌握。
总之,从零学习编程语言需要具备基本的数学和逻辑思维能力,有学习意愿和耐心,具备编程思维,拥有合适的学习资源和工具,并通过实践和项目经验来提高编程技能。
1年前 -
-
从零学习编程语言需要具备以下要求:
-
基本的计算机知识:了解计算机的基本原理和组成部分,包括中央处理器(CPU)、内存、硬盘、操作系统等。同时,对于计算机的基本操作,如文件管理、文件编辑等也要有一定的了解。
-
数学基础:编程语言通常涉及到数学运算和逻辑判断,因此具备基本的数学知识是必要的。尤其是对于算法和数据结构的学习,数学基础是不可或缺的。
-
解决问题的能力:编程是一种解决问题的方式,因此需要具备良好的问题分析和解决能力。学习编程语言时,需要学会将问题拆解为较小的子问题,并逐步解决。
-
学习能力和自学能力:编程语言的学习是一个不断学习和实践的过程,需要具备良好的学习能力和自学能力。掌握好学习方法和技巧,能够主动寻找学习资源和解决问题的方法。
-
耐心和毅力:学习编程语言是一个相对较长的过程,需要耐心和毅力去克服困难和挑战。编程中常会遇到错误和bug,需要耐心地调试和解决。
学习编程语言的方法和步骤如下:
-
选择合适的编程语言:根据自己的兴趣和需求,选择一门适合初学者的编程语言。常见的入门编程语言包括Python、Java、C++等。
-
学习基本语法和语法规则:了解编程语言的基本语法和语法规则,包括变量、数据类型、运算符、控制流程、函数等基本概念和语法结构。可以通过阅读教材、参考资料、在线教程等途径学习。
-
实践编程:通过编写简单的程序来巩固所学的知识。可以选择一些简单的编程练习题或者小项目来进行实践,逐步提升自己的编程能力。
-
学习算法和数据结构:算法和数据结构是编程的核心,对于编程语言的学习来说也是必不可少的。学习和理解常见的算法和数据结构,如排序算法、查找算法、链表、栈、队列等。
-
阅读和理解源代码:通过阅读和理解他人编写的源代码,可以学习到更多的编程技巧和实践经验。可以选择一些开源项目,阅读其中的源代码,了解其设计思想和实现方法。
-
参与编程社区和交流:加入编程社区、参加编程讨论和交流活动,与他人分享经验和学习成果。可以通过论坛、博客、社交媒体等平台进行交流。
总之,学习编程语言需要具备基本的计算机知识和数学基础,同时需要具备解决问题的能力和学习能力。通过选择合适的编程语言,学习基本语法和规则,实践编程,学习算法和数据结构,阅读源代码,参与编程社区和交流,可以逐步提升自己的编程能力。
1年前 -